| SRVUSD Curriculum Standards |
| Benchmarks |
Skills |
| Grade One |
|
Understands and uses basic computer operations.
|
- Identifies physical components of the computer (e.g., monitor, keyboard, mouse, CPU, diskdrive, power switch, CD ROM drive).
- Identify peripherals used with computer (e.g., printer, scanner, headset).
- Knows how to remove and insert removable storage media.
- Uses a basic keyboard and mouse.
- Understands and uses fundamental computer vocabulary(desktop, cursor, menubar, folder, and other appropriate terms).
|
|
Exhibits proper care of equipment.
|
- Keeps computer areas free of food and drink.
|
| Grade Two |
|
Understands and uses basic computer operations.
|
- Knows how to turn on and shut down a computer.
- Uses both hands on a basic keyboard with mouse.
- Uses spacebar, letter and number keys, shift, delete, return, and arrow keys.
- Opens and quits an application.
- Open, scrolls and closes a window.
- Uses cancel as a troubleshooting technique.
- Knows how to save and recall within a program.
|
|
Exhibits proper care of equipment.
|
- Handles removable storage media properly.
|
| Grade Three |
|
Understands and uses basic computer operations.
|
- Inserts and removes removable storage media.
- Uses home row placement for hands on keyboard.
- Locates and uses upper and lowercase letters, numbers, symbols and special keys (e.g., Command, Alt, Option, CapsLock).
- Uses undo as a troubleshooting technique.
- Uses fundamental computer operating environment, i.e., desktop, cursor, menubar, folder. Understands there is a lag time in printing.
- Knows how to print with supervision.
|
|
Exhibits proper care of equipment.
|
- Stores removable storage media safely.
- Understands the consequences of poor storage and care of removable storage media.
|
| Grade Four |
|
Understands and uses basic computer operations.
|
- Knows when an application is open.
- Titles and saves work to an identified location (e.g., hard drive, external device).
- Locates and retrieves prior work. Accesses files from external disk and/or network server.
- Uses home row on the computer proficiently (5 wpm).
- Understands and uses the PRINT dialog box.
- Uses input devices (e.g., microphone to record sound).
|
| Grade Five |
|
Understands and uses basic computer operations.
|
- Uses all alpha keys to key at least 12 wpm with 90% accuracy.
- Navigates to appropriate locations to save and retrieve a document.
- Knows when peripherals are on and operating (printer, modem, scanner, QuickCam, etc.)
- Knows common system problems and asks for help.
- Inserts, plays and rewinds a video tape in a VCR.
- Uses image input devices with supervision (e.g., camera, scanner).
- Knows and uses basic technology components (e.g., VCR, stereo, CD players).
